Service is finally scheduled for next tuesday. I just bought the car in May with 47k on it and have no idea what services were done on it prior. I am hoping everything was done by BMW by their schedule but you never know. I thought to be on the safe side I would get the coolant flushed besides the oil change. I have been reading that a lot of guys service the AWD differentials at 50k so I was thinking about that as well. What have you guys done or recommend? Any idea what kind of cost to have that all done? Is there a standard oil you use for the N52 or will the dealer try to upsell because I am new?

There is only one type of oil for each part, so there is no upsell there for you. When I purchased my 330xi I had many fluids changed, nothing that BMW says needs to be done, but I just did for peace of mind. I had the front and rear differentials, and the transfer case fluid changed. As well as the engine coolant, power steering fluid, and transmission fluid. It wasnt cheap, but well worth it IMO if you are keeping the car for a long time.
